Rockwell Automation introduces 800B 16 mm Push Buttons
February 3, 2011 — Rockwell Automation introduces 800B 16 mm Push Buttons for Original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) and end users needing compact, reliable Push Buttons for light industrial and instrumentation applications.

The Allen-Bradley 800B 16 mm Push Buttons help reduce maintenance and associated downtime costs with LED pilot lights that can indicate if a motor is in operation and trigger-action emergency-stop (E-stop) devices that cease motion. The E-stop Push Button features a trigger-action anti-tease to help ensure the E-stop command will disengage equipment, helping to improve worker safety.

The line provides reliability by meeting global standards, including UL, CSA, CE and CCC. The entire family is constructed of durable corrosion-resistant plastic materials that provide great dependability in sealing (IP65/66) and help to extend the overall product life. For improved visibility and comfort, the 800B devices offer bright, consistent illumination with an ergonomic concave shape.

Users with light industrial applications can now benefit from Allen-Bradley industry-leading knowledge of the industrial Push Button market. Rockwell Automation Integrated Architecture users benefit from the low-voltage, gold-plated contact blocks and LEDs with leakage current shunt. Both help improve I/O signal quality and operation uptime. The new 800B product line takes many of the features of Allen-Bradley 22.5 mm and 30 mm Push Button families and puts them in a 16 mm size design. This gives users more flexibility to precisely match the available space.


“Push Buttons are often taken for granted, but they are the first line of defense against very expensive malfunctions,” said Paul Gieschen, market development director, Rockwell Automation. “They must stand up to repeated use and the punishment of industrial environments.”
